Hi Everyone,
I am new here and have a question would like get your thoughts and suggestions.
I have a 2016 JD 3032E with D160 FEL. I am going to add a grapple to the loader. For the 3rd function hydraulics, I will have the WR Long Valve Kit. Now the question is how to identify the power beyond port. Photo 1 shows three black steel lines A, B and C that all directly go to the transmission from the loader control valve. One of the steel lines is the power beyond, but which one?
Some observations: Line A goes to the bottom of the transmission; B and C go to the right side of transmission (see photo 2). On the 90 degree silver elbow where Line A is connected to the loader valve (see photo 1), a letter "P" is found on it (see photo 3).
Looking forward to hearing from you! Thanks.
